一般都自带了中文字体和输入法了。进图形界面就可以操作了。
如果没有装,那就请先去喷装这个系统的人在 zhuangbility 。之后再喷这些文件的用户竟然用中文这么不专业的行为。
有的程序可以用文件的 inode 访问,不过只有很少的程序支持。
不过你可以试试用 inode 反查方式输出文件名返给程序用。
这个方法请找服务器管理员,我反正是没用过这种方式操作。
如果你的 linux 机在局域网里面,找个有中文支持的计算机上,用 ssh 或者 scp 程序远程访问服务器就能操作中文文件了。
⑵ Linux修改文件名技巧大全linux怎么修改文件名
Linux是一种开源操作系统,在分布式计算机系统中十分流行。与其他类型的操作系统不同,它通过命令行界面进行操作,以更快、更简单的方式来操作文件。而修改文件名是在使用Linux时一个最常见的任务了,想要有效地修改文件名,必须熟悉Linux相关的技巧和命令,本文要谈讨的就是这些文件名修改技巧。
首先,我们介绍最常用的修改文件名技巧,也就是使用mv命令进行修改。mv是Linux中的一个内置命令,用于移动文件和修改文件名,通常使用如下格式:mv [option] [origin name] [modify name]。在这里,orginal name和modify name分别为文件的原来文件名和想要修改的文件名,option选项可以使用一定的选项来指定文件的转移方式,或者使用-h参数修改文件的创建时间等,最常用的就是-i选项,这个选项可以让用户重命名时进行确认,确保文件不会被覆盖。
其次,还有一些快捷方式可以帮助用户便捷修改文件名,比如在Terminal界面下,可以先使用ls命令查看文件列表,然后使用more命令让它以页面的形式一页一页的显示出来,这样就可以比较容易的找到想要修改的文件,然后结合mv命令即可完成文件名的修改。
第三,Linux也支持通过脚本文件来编写修改文件名的程序。在Linux中,可以用脚本编写一个能搜索特定字符,并把搜索到的特定字符替换为新字符的程序,这样就可以一次性地修改多个文件,更加方便快捷。
最后,还可以使用Linux系统自带的文件浏览器,如KDE工作空间管理器,Finder或Dolphin等来修改文件名,只要打开想要改的文件夹,右键点击文件,接着点击右键菜单上的Rename,再在窗口中输入新修改的名字,就可以完成文件名的修改了。
以上就是Linux修改文件名技巧大全,比起在window下修改文件名,通过Linux终端命令可以更加方便快捷,而且还可以一次性的把文件的名字批量的修改,效率很高。但也要注意文件的表达格式,否则会出现错误。
⑶ 如何linux忽略文件名大小写
linux系统本身就是大小写敏感的,所以如果你有类似下面两个文件
LINUX和linux,系统是会认为是2个文件,所以不能忽略大小写
⑷ linux脚本中我知道文件名的一部分,如何判断此文件存在
你应该是想找符合两个匹配条件的文件,find有个-o的参专数
#!属/bin/bash
foriin`find/root/-typef-name"*b.txt"-o"a-b.txt"`;
do
echo$i;
done
⑸ linux如何快速打开文件名过长的文件
你可以使用键盘的抄袭Tab补全文件名。
例如:
有个文件linux123456789.txt
方法:
1.你在shell中输入,vim liunx
2.按下你键盘的Tab键(linux会补全文件名)
你可以搜索bash tab键
⑹ Linux c语言从全路径中截取除去文件名外的路径
代码如下:来
#include<stdio.h>
#include<string.h>
intmain()
{
chars[]="D:\test\20181207.dll";
char*p;
chars2[100];
p=strrchr(s,'\');
if(p!=NULL){
//如果想复制到源k另一个字符串,可以使用strncpy
strncpy(s2,s,(p-s));
printf("%s ",s2);
//如果想在原字符串修改的话,可以给*p直接赋值
*p='